Kawazu Seven Falls, a renowned scenic spot with a prestigious two-star rating in the Michelin Green Guide Japan, offers a beautifully maintained walking path, making it easy to explore. Along the way, enjoy charming stops where you can make a wish by tossing a stone or follow a route through statues of the Seven Lucky Gods. Immerse yourself in an authentic Japanese mountain village, where traditional lifestyles thrive and local culture comes alive. In Sugari, experience the beauty of each season and enjoy a unique glimpse into rural Japan.
Savor handmade soba noodles, beloved by locals, alongside seasonal dishes made from fresh, local ingredients. These meals reflect the essence of Japanese home cooking, showcasing flavors from the surrounding mountains and fields.
Sugari offers rich seasonal activities: hand-pick tea leaves in spring, enjoy blueberry picking in summer, and take in vibrant autumn landscapes. Visit a local ceramic studio renowned for its stunning jet-black pottery, where an up-and-coming artist creates unique pieces using natural glazes. These works are available for purchase, allowing you to bring home a piece of this enchanting place.

We depart from Tokyo in the middle of the night and drive to Hottarakashi Onsen in Yamanashi
You’ll arrive in time to bathe under the stars and witness the sunrise over Mt. Fuji
After your soak, enjoy a traditional Japanese breakfast at the onsen’s mountaintop café
We return to Tokyo before noon, giving you the rest of the day to explore or relax
